150th Annual Westminster Kennel Club Dog Show Begins in New York City

The 150th Annual Westminster Kennel Club Dog Show officially kicked off on January 31, 2026, marking a monumental occasion in the world of purebred dogs and American cultural traditions. Held at the Jacob K. Javits Convention Center in New York City, this historic event celebrates a sesquicentennial of dog competitions, attracting more than 3,000 dogs from over 200 different breeds to participate in various categories, including agility, confirmation, and showmanship.

The Westminster Kennel Club Dog Show is renowned for its prestige and tradition, and this year’s event honors the show’s rich history with a special presentation called Westminster Legends, highlighting the legacy and evolution of the competition over the past 150 years. The celebration underscores Westminster’s status as a pillar of American cultural life, drawing participants, enthusiasts, and fans from across the country and around the world.

Throughout the weekend, the competition continues with several rounds of judging, showcasing the incredible talents of these dogs and their handlers. The event provides a platform for breeds from all corners of the globe to demonstrate their qualities, agility, and conformation to breed standards, with a particular focus on both beauty and skill.

The excitement culminates in the Best in Show competition, which is set to take place on February 3, 2026, at Madison Square Garden. This iconic venue, which has hosted many of Westminster’s most memorable moments, remains synonymous with the event, helping solidify the show’s place in the cultural fabric of U.S. life.
